The Let Experienced Pilots Fly Act raises the mandatory retirement age for commercial pilots from 65 to 67 while maintaining the requirements for first-class medical and training certifications. When the U.S. last raised the retirement age in 2007, from 60 to 65, medical reports concluded that age had an insignificant impact on performance in the cockpit and that regulations already outlined safety precautions to prevent accidents in case of incapacitation. The current retirement age of 65 was set in 2007 when the age was raised from 60, an age that had been set back in 1960.
